Linux MySQL连接执行

在进行软件开发和数据库管理时,经常需要在Linux操作系统上连接和执行MySQL数据库。MySQL是一个流行的关系型数据库管理系统,它提供了丰富的功能和灵活的配置选项,使得它成为许多开发人员和数据管理人员的首选。

本文将介绍如何在Linux操作系统上连接和执行MySQL数据库,并展示一些常见的操作示例。我们将会使用命令行工具来连接到MySQL数据库,并执行一些基本的数据库操作。

连接到MySQL数据库

在Linux操作系统上连接到MySQL数据库最简单的方法是使用命令行工具。首先,确保已经安装了MySQL服务器,并且MySQL服务正在运行。然后打开终端窗口,输入以下命令连接到MySQL数据库:

mysql -u 用户名 -p

其中,-u参数用于指定要连接的数据库用户,-p参数表示需要输入密码。输入密码后,如果连接成功,将会看到MySQL数据库的命令行提示符。

执行SQL语句

一旦连接到MySQL数据库,我们就可以执行各种SQL语句来操作数据库表和数据。以下是一些常见的SQL语句示例:

创建数据库

CREATE DATABASE mydatabase;

使用数据库

USE mydatabase;

创建表

CREATE TABLE users (
    id INT PRIMARY KEY,
    name VARCHAR(50),
    email VARCHAR(50)
);

插入数据

INSERT INTO users (id, name, email) VALUES (1, 'Alice', 'alice@example.com');

查询数据

SELECT * FROM users;

更新数据

UPDATE users SET email='alice.new@example.com' WHERE id=1;

删除数据

DELETE FROM users WHERE id=1;

类图

classDiagram
    class MySQL {
        + connect()
        + executeQuery()
        + executeUpdate()
    }

以上是一个简单的MySQL类图,表示一个MySQL类,包含连接数据库和执行SQL语句的方法。

饼状图

pie
    title 数据库表占比
    "用户" : 40
    "订单" : 30
    "产品" : 20
    "其他" : 10

以上是一个简单的饼状图,表示数据库中不同表的占比情况。

在Linux操作系统上连接和执行MySQL数据库并不困难,只需遵循一些简单的步骤和命令即可完成。通过命令行工具连接到MySQL数据库,可以执行各种SQL语句来管理数据库表和数据,非常方便和高效。

希望本文能够帮助您更好地理解在Linux操作系统上连接和执行MySQL数据库的方法,同时也能够为您的软件开发和数据库管理工作提供一些参考和指导。祝您工作顺利!